Ranibandha - Gopabandhunagar, Mayurbhanj
Ranibandha is a village situated in the Gopabandhunagar tehsil of Mayurbhanj district, Odisha. It is located approximately 22 km from Khunta and around 37 km from Baripada. Ranibandha village is a designated Gram Panchayat.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Ranibandha is 390910. The village covers a total geographical area of 259 hectares and falls under the 757026 pincode. Udala is the nearest town, located about 27 km away.
Ranibandha village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Udala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Mayurbhanj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Ranibandha
As per Census 2011, Ranibandha village has a total population of 1,468 people, consisting of 733 males and 735 females. The village has 360 households and a sex ratio of 1,002 females per 1,000 males. There are 182 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 774 literate and 694 illiterate residents. Additionally, 26 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 1,222 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Ranibandha are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,468 | 733 | 735 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 182 | 90 | 92 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 26 | 13 | 13 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 1,222 | 610 | 612 |
| Literate Population | 774 | 453 | 321 |
| Illiterate Population | 694 | 280 | 414 |

Transport and Connectivity of Ranibandha
Ranibandha is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Udala to Ranibandha is about 27 km, with a usual travel time of around 1-1.25 hours. Similarly, the road distance from Baripada to Ranibandha is about 37 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Ranibandha
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Ranibandha village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Post Office | Yes | Available within village |
Health Facilities in Ranibandha
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Ranibandha village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
